Enugu State Government Approves Half Day Work On Friday by nghubs1(m): 10:31pm On Nov 02, 2017
Ahead of the Local Government elections, the Enugu state government has approved a half day work for public servants on Friday 3rd November.

According to a statement released by Secretary to the State Government G. O. C. Ajah, and made available to NGHUBS, the half day work is to enable workers travel to where they are registered for election.

He added that all financial institutions, federal establishments and private sector organizations are not affected by this directive.

November 2, 2017

Public Service Announcement

Enugu State Government has approved that all Public and Civil Servants in the State should observe half-day work on Friday, 3rd November, 2017 due to the Local Government Elections in the State coming up on Saturday, 4th November, 2017.

This is to enable all Public/Civil Servants and Teachers in the State to travel to where they registered for the elections.

All financial institutions, federal establishments and private sector organizations are not affected by this directive.

There will be restrictions of movements on the election day being Saturday, 4th November, 2017 from 8:00 am to 4:00 pm, in accordance with the Enugu State Independent Electoral Commission (ENSIEC) regulations, except for those on election duties and essential services.

G. O. C. Ajah, mni, Ph.D

Secretary to the State Government
